The committee on Regulatory Licensing Reform reports and recommends:
Assembly Bill 188
Relating to: educational requirements for taking the accounting examination or receiving a certified public accountant certificate; continuing education requirements for accounting license renewal; data-sharing programs related to accountants; peer reviews for certified public accounting firms; modifying various administrative rules promulgated by the Accounting Examining Board relating to accounting; and granting rule-making authority.
hist71328Passage:
Ayes: 7 - Representatives Ballweg, Hutton, Jacque, Macco, Quinn, Genrich and Anderson.
Noes: 1 - Representative Horlacher.
hist71329To committee on Rules.
